Output 95d3c10e3c1fbe34ce0afa0c6054a38fa77cbc5d6060de2aa1bb47d2e68df9d8:24

value
969061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71f1cda81d8403528eb78862313a586aa632d6fa OP_EQUAL
address
3C5Vx1dRHr49juYRRtPcm2vML67ZFRADB6
transaction
95d3c10e3c1fbe34ce0afa0c6054a38fa77cbc5d6060de2aa1bb47d2e68df9d8
spent
true